My child is turning 26

It’s rewarding to watch your kids become independent adults. Part of their transition to adulthood involves moving from your benefits coverage to coverage of their own.

If your child reaches age 26, the maximum age limit for benefits coverage, you have 31 days from his or her birthday to make changes to your benefits.

Medical, dental, vision

  • Coverage for your child automatically ends on the last day of the month in which he or she reaches age 26.
  • Your child will receive a COBRA packet that contains important information about his or her right to continue health insurance through COBRA and how to enroll.

Flexible Spending Accounts

  • You can change or stop your Health Care Flexible Spending Account (FSA) contributions.
  • If your child is no longer considered your tax dependent, you can no longer submit expenses for him or her to the Health Care FSA.

To make changes to your benefits, call Alight at 866-468-8236 within 31 days of the date that your child reaches the maximum age limit.
